PennDOT Releases EV Videos, Funding for Charging Stations
The state Department of Transportation has released the “EVs in Focus” video series, which helps answer questions Pennsylvanians may have about electric vehicles. Three videos are currently available covering the topics of Battery Fires, The Electric Grid, and Environmental Impacts. PennDOT recently announced 12 federal National Electric Vehicle Infrastructure (NEVI) project awards from the Corridor Connections Funding Opportunity totaling $9 million in federal funding. These projects build on prior NEVI projects to enable EV travel on more long-distance roadways throughout Pennsylvania. The PennDOT NEVI Community Charging webpage provide information about the regional community charging funding rounds, which are open to businesses and nonprofits. The southeastern region funding opportunity is currently available, and the other regions are scheduled for release this spring and summer.
